Pattern file names used as categories for display
Summary:
Apparently, the categories for the patterns in the Pattern editor are taken from the pattern file names (which are currently CamelCase, but there's a fix/workaround for it in inkscape!5330 (merged)).
A real fix would be a title text in the files, though. So the patterns.svg.h file would probably need to do some parsing of the SVG files and look for a svg:title element (which can be set in Document properties).
Steps to reproduce:
- open Inkscape
- draw object
- apply pattern
- look at category names in English for patterns
What happened?
CamelCase, taken from file name
What should have happened?
Files should contain a title, and that should be used for the category name.
